Akshay's 'Holiday' crosses 100 crore mark

India Blooms News Service | | 23 Jun 2014, 12:02 am
Mumbai, June 22 (IBNS): Bollywood superstar Akshay Kumar's 'Holiday: A Soldier Is Never Off Duty' has entered the 100 crore club in three weeks.

"#Holiday [Week 3] Fri 1.02 cr, Sat 1.87 cr. Grand total:  102.62 cr nett. India biz. HIT," Bollywood trade analyst and film critic Taran Adarsh tweeted.

The film, which was released on June 6, features superstar Akshay Kumar and Sonakshi Sinha in lead roles.

Meanwhile,filmmaker Sajid Khan's 'Humshakals' crossed the 25-crore mark since it hit theatres  released on Friday.

Adarsh tweeted: " #Humshakals Fri 12.50 cr, Sat 12.59 cr. Total: 25.09 cr nett. India biz."
